WebBiotic Factors. The taiga is characterized by coniferous forests consisting mostly of pines, spruces and larches. The main species varies, for example the North American taiga is dominated by spruces, the East Siberian taiga by larches. These evergreen trees shade the understory, so shrubs struggle to survive, and mosses and lichens dominate there. WebApr 8, 2024 · The exact species, however, differ between taiga and tundra. For example, moose and deer can be found in the taiga, while reindeer are more common in the tundra. The polar bear lives in the tundra, while the grizzly lives in the taiga. Bird species differ between the two biomes as well. Songbirds that consume insects and nuts, such as jays …
